Bootstrap的維護(hù)者宣布,他們將停止維護(hù)這個流行框架的v3版本(當(dāng)前版本)。
Bootstrap創(chuàng)建者M(jìn)ark Otto在一個GitHub問題中表示,將停止Bootstrap v3相關(guān)的工作:
長話短說,v4已經(jīng)耗時太久了。我知道,我們得努力騰出足夠的時間,以便更快地處理打開的問題和PR。為了幫助達(dá)成這個目標(biāo),我要從v3相關(guān)的工作中騰出時間。這里,我概括了剩余的幾個主要步驟,以便大家知道關(guān)于v4還有哪些工作要做。
Otto接著關(guān)閉了版本3所有的遺留問題,并表示“任何新的針對v3的修改都是不合規(guī)和反常的。”
這種情況有點罕見,因為版本3是該產(chǎn)品的當(dāng)前版本。在下個版本發(fā)布并穩(wěn)定之前,許多項目都不會停止支持當(dāng)前版本。Bootstrap 4的第一個Alpha版本發(fā)布已經(jīng)一年多,目前尚未達(dá)到Beta狀態(tài)。Alpha 4是在2016年9月5日發(fā)布的。
任何有兼職工作的開發(fā)人員都知道,在全職工作的同時維護(hù)那樣的項目有多么困難。開源開發(fā),尤其還是一個非常受歡迎的項目,還是非常具有挑戰(zhàn)性的。Otto對這一觀點表示贊同,并提供了更多有關(guān)這一決定的背景信息:
我們之中從事Bootstrap開發(fā)的每一個人都有一份全職工作。我不喜歡一開始就說這樣的話,但我在GitHub的工作占據(jù)了我的大部分時間。維護(hù)一個大型代碼庫的兩個版本出乎意外地繁重。一年多來,我們都在為此努力,但只是讓我們進(jìn)一步陷入了問題和PR的泥潭。為了推動項目向前發(fā)展,我們必須放棄些什么,而積極的v3開發(fā)就是我們放棄的東西。
對于這件事,兩個社區(qū)的反應(yīng)并不相同。在Reddit上,反應(yīng)都是負(fù)面的。mpasteven評論說,“這可能導(dǎo)致一些人放棄這個框架,尤其是當(dāng)管理層需要一切都有技術(shù)支持時。”
在GitHub上,討論主要是圍繞v3是否穩(wěn)定、項目所有權(quán)和潛在的籌資方式等方面展開。
對于v3進(jìn)一步的工作,Otto留下了一定的空間,但他終止了有關(guān)收費(fèi)的話題:
V3將100%可用,而且穩(wěn)定。澄清一下,我們?nèi)ツ暌呀?jīng)很少維護(hù)v3,只接受關(guān)鍵修復(fù)和文檔更新。對于Bootstrap,我們絕對沒有收費(fèi)計劃。從來沒有。
查看英文原文:Regular Maintenance for Bootstrap v3 Ends